Excerpt from Will the Home Survive? A Study of Tendencies in Modern Literature<br><br>Will the family, that institution which we have long regarded as the unit Of civilization, the foundation Of the state, survive? The very form Of the question may startle us, but we have to recall only a few facts to'remind ourselves that the family of our fathers' time has almost entirely gone. Its going has not been caused by any revolution, it has passed so imperceptibly that we scarcely realize that it has gone.
